Mixed Use

Second and Lenora

Seattle, Washington

Located in Seattle's trendy Belltown neighborhood, this five-story, $14.7 million building includes 107 apartments, 7,389 sf of retail space, and 108 below-grade parking stalls. Early on in the process, our staff attended community meetings to present the project and receive comments, resulting in a building that was well received by the community.  During construction, a tower crane was used for efficiency in the confined space, positioning the construction site office, work preparation, and storage platforms over the sidewalks to allow ongoing pedestrian traffic. The completed exterior building design utilizes architectural concrete, stucco and Hardi panels, with ceramic tile at the window heads and a metal cornice for accents. Aluminum storefront was used in the commercial sections to enhance the overall presentation of the building, while over-sized vinyl windows provide a distinctive feature that mimics the old style of the nearby Terminal Sales Building.
